Review of Adhura

Adhura (2023)
6/10
Better than most of Indian horror movies but miles away from Tumbbad
11 July 2023
With the young crew members, school background, and good actors like Ishwaq and Rashika, you ought to believe that this is gonna be one hell of a story and you're gonna be thrilled even more when you get to know that it involves some supernatural powers with horrifying small stories. The entire web-series circles around a peculiar friendship involving a homosexual boy and a meritorious student. With the predictable yet attractive twists and turns, this series somehow keeps you spellbound with good acting from Shrenik, Ishwaq and Rashika. Rest all young actors from the 2007 batch acted overly. Anyway, at the end you'll feel betrayed when the ghost was worse than Ramsay's and the story wasn't upto the standard Tumbbad has set but it still magnets you for a bold attempt in this unexplored genre for Bollywood.
